> >> >> One clarifying comment about the CLI and the proposed interfaces.
> >> >>
> >> >> The CLI handles two methods of executing a query: on a cluster and
> >> >> when no cluster is specified. When a cluster is specified, the query
> >> >> should be submitted to the RESTful API. As for when a cluster does
> not
> >> >> exist, the CLI creates a temporary cluster to execute the query. The
> >> >> same process can continue, but now we have the option of using the
> >> >> current method or update to using the RESTful API of the temporary
> >> >> cluster.
> >> >>
> >> >> Basically, we should always use the RESTful API when possible so we
> >> >> only need to support one API.

> >> >> >> > > Hi Erandi,
> >> >> >> > >
> >> >> >> > > Similar to my comment on the issue. Our goal is to get a Web
> >> >> Interface
> >> >> >> > > for executing queries. To achieve this goal we have three
> steps:
> >> >> >> > >
> >> >> >> > > 1. Implement a RESTful API (most of the documentation is
> >> complete)
> >> >> >> > > 2. Update current query execution path to use the RESTful API
> >> >> (command
> >> >> >> > > line query execution)
> >> >> >> > > 3. Implement a simple web interface for single query execution
> >> >> >> > > 4. Update the web interface for more advance operations
> (showing
> >> >> query
> >> >> >> > > plans, asynchronous jobs, etc.)
> >> >> >> > >
> >> >> >> > > Our sister project AsterixDB has designed a HTTP API we would
> >> like
> >> >> to
> >> >> >> > > emulate: https://cwiki.apache.org/
> confluence/display/ASTERIXDB/
> >> >> >> > > New+HTTP+API+Design.
> >> >> >> > > Both projects build on Hyracks and in the future could move
> the
> >> API
> >> >> >> > > into into this shared dependent project. Consider these tasks
> >> and
> >> >> your
> >> >> >> > > skill level and come up with what steps you think you could
> >> achieve
> >> >> >> > > during the summer.
